The Product Manager will define the strategy for Dream Machine, oversee product development, and enhance user engagement for consumer-focused AI creative tools.
Our mission is to build multimodal AI to expand human imagination and capabilities.
We believe that multimodality is critical for intelligence. To go beyond language models and build more aware, capable and useful systems, the next step function change will come from vision. So we are working on training and scaling up multimodal foundation models for systems that can see and understand, show and explain, and eventually interact with our world to effect change.
We’re seeking a consumer focused Product Manager who lives and breathes product-led growth (PLG) and creative workflows. You’ll own the roadmap, drive rapid adoption, and set PM best practices from day one. You’ll partner with research, engineering, design, and marketing to turn visionary AI research into polished, high-impact features loved by creators.
What You’ll Do
- Define and execute the end-to-end product strategy for Luma, translating user insights into AI-driven creative features.
- Launch and iterate on pro-level photo and video tools, driving growth in active users.
- Lead cross-functional sprints, balance trade-offs, and maintain a clear roadmap in a fast-paced environment.
- Conduct user research with professional creators to validate feature ideas and optimize engagement loops.
- Establish A/B testing and analytics for core interactions (e.g., brush tools, masking, timeline scrubbing).
- Collaborate on go-to-market plans to ensure successful feature launches and adoption.
Who You Are
- 5+ years shipping consumer-facing creative or editing tools (web or mobile) for professional audiences.
- Deep expertise in photo/video workflows and UI/UX prototyping (wireframes, micro-interactions, pixel polish).
- Strong analytics background: comfortable defining metrics, building funnels, and iterating on retention.
- Excellent communicator who thrives in high-agency, ambiguous environments.
- Passionate about AI and eager to integrate generative and automation technologies into your roadmap.
